Heirloom Tea Varieties: What They Are and Why They Matter

Heirloom tea varieties are seed-propagated tea plants with unique genetic diversity that produces complex, multi-layered flavor profiles unlike anything a modern clonal cultivar can replicate. The industry term for these plants is “Qun Ti Zhong,” meaning “group body seed,” a phrase used across Chinese tea regions to describe seed-grown populations where every bush is genetically distinct. If you grow, brew, or study tea seriously, understanding what heirloom tea varieties are changes how you read a flavor note, evaluate a garden, and choose what to put in your cup.

What are heirloom tea varieties, and how are they defined?

Heirloom tea is defined as tea produced from old, seed-propagated trees or bushes valued for genetic diversity and complex, layered flavor profiles. The contrast with clonal cultivars is biological and fundamental. Clonal teas are grown from cuttings, so every plant in a field shares identical DNA. Heirloom teas grow from seed, so every plant is a genetic individual, the way siblings share parents but not fingerprints.

That genetic individuality is the source of everything tea enthusiasts prize about heirlooms. Flavor compounds, root depth, leaf shape, and sprouting time all vary from bush to bush. The result is a cup that carries what growers call terroir: a sensory record of the specific soil, altitude, and microclimate where the plant grew. Named heirloom populations include Qun Ti Zhong from China’s Fujian and Yunnan provinces, Xiao Cai Cha from high-altitude Taiwanese gardens, and Japan’s Zairai teas, each representing centuries of seed-selection in a specific landscape.

How do heirloom tea varieties differ from modern clonal cultivars?

The core difference is propagation method. Heirloom teas reproduce sexually through seed. Modern cultivars like Longjing #43 reproduce asexually through cuttings, guaranteeing that every plant is a genetic copy of the original. Clonal propagation guarantees consistent flavor but sacrifices the genetic diversity and complexity that seed-grown populations produce.

The commercial consequences are significant. Longjing #43 sprouts 7–10 days earlier than traditional heirloom types, and early-harvest teas command up to 3 times higher prices in the Chinese market. That economic advantage drove widespread adoption of clonal varieties across major tea-producing regions. Heirloom gardens lost ground not because the tea was inferior, but because the harvest calendar was unpredictable.

Visual identification separates the two clearly. Clonal teas like Longjing #43 have uniform, slim, spear-like buds. Heirloom bushes produce irregular, mixed-size buds with varied leaf morphologies across the same row. That visual “messiness” is actually a sign of genetic health.

Characteristic Heirloom tea Modern clonal cultivar
Propagation method Seed (sexual) Cutting (asexual)
Genetic profile Heterogeneous Uniform
Bud appearance Irregular, varied sizes Uniform, slim, spear-like
Harvest timing Uneven, later Predictable, earlier
Flavor complexity Multi-layered, terroir-driven Consistent, less complex
Economic yield Lower, variable Higher, predictable

Pro Tip: When buying loose-leaf tea labeled “heirloom” or “Qun Ti Zhong,” look for a mix of bud sizes and leaf shapes in the dry leaf. Uniform, identical leaves are a reliable sign of clonal origin, regardless of what the label says.

What are some notable heirloom tea types and their flavor profiles?

The best heirloom teas share one trait: flavor that changes across multiple steepings rather than delivering a single flat note. That depth comes from genetic diversity within the plant population and from the chemical compounds that seed-grown bushes accumulate over decades.

Notable heirloom varieties and their defining characteristics:

  • Qun Ti Zhong (China): The foundational Chinese heirloom category. Produces floral, orchid-forward notes with a pronounced Hui Gan, the lingering sweet aftertaste that returns minutes after swallowing. Found across Fujian, Yunnan, and Guangdong provinces.
  • Xiao Cai Cha (Taiwan): A small-leaf heirloom variety grown at high altitude. Delivers chestnut and wild honey notes with a clean, mineral finish. Prized by Taiwanese oolong producers for its natural sweetness.
  • Zairai (Japan): Japanese seed-propagated varieties that preserve genetic diversity and historical authenticity absent in modern clonal cultivars. Specialty buyers prize Zairai for its earthy, savory depth and the subtle variation between individual plants in the same field.
  • Ancient Yunnan heirloom trees: Some trees in Yunnan’s ancient gardens are estimated 200–500 years old. These trees exhibit elevated levels of theacrine, anthocyanins, and methyl salicylate. Those compounds produce the purple-tinged leaves and complex, slightly bitter-then-sweet flavor profile associated with aged-tree puer.
  • Zhenghe heirloom white tea: Grown in Fujian’s Zhenghe county, this variety produces the large, downy buds used in traditional white peony (Bai Mu Dan) production. The flavor is delicate, hay-like, and faintly fruity.

Heirloom teas produce a deeper aftertaste and more complex terroir character due to deeper root systems compared to shallower-rooted clones. Deeper roots access a broader mineral profile in the soil, which translates directly into the cup. What are the advantages and challenges of growing heirloom tea varieties?

Growing heirloom tea is a long-term commitment. The advantages are real, but so are the practical difficulties. Growers who choose heirloom cultivation accept a different set of trade-offs than those running clonal operations.

Advantages of heirloom cultivation:

  1. Genetic resilience. A genetically diverse population is less vulnerable to a single pest or disease. If one bush in a heirloom garden is susceptible to a pathogen, neighboring bushes with different genetics may resist it. Monoculture clonal fields carry the opposite risk.
  2. Flavor complexity. Every heirloom bush is genetically unique, contributing variation in flavor within a single harvest. That variation, when blended by a skilled producer, creates layered cups that single-cultivar clonal teas cannot produce.
  3. Authenticity and market positioning. Specialty tea buyers and herbalists increasingly seek seed-grown teas for their historical authenticity. The specialty tea movement’s interest in heirlooms is a deliberate embrace of genetic diversity lost in modern clonal cultivation.
  4. Deep root development. Seed-grown plants develop taproots that penetrate deeper into the soil than cutting-grown plants. Deeper roots mean better drought tolerance and access to a wider mineral profile.

Challenges growers face:

  1. Uneven sprouting. Heirloom bushes have significant genetic heterogeneity within a field, leading to irregular harvest times. Growers cannot pick an entire field in one pass, which increases labor costs.
  2. Lower and variable yields. Heirloom plants do not produce the consistent flush volume that clonal varieties deliver. Yield depends on the individual plant’s genetics, age, and microsite conditions.
  3. Later harvest timing. Heirloom teas typically sprout later than modern cultivars, missing the premium early-spring price window that clonal teas like Longjing #43 capture.
  4. Market competition. Clonal teas dominate commercial supply chains. Heirloom producers compete on quality and story, not volume or price efficiency.

Pro Tip: When identifying seed-grown heirloom bushes in a garden, look for variation in leaf color, size, and texture across adjacent plants. A row of bushes that all look identical is almost certainly clonal. Natural variation between neighboring plants is the clearest field indicator of seed origin.

How does local ecology shape heirloom tea flavor?

Terroir is not a marketing term for heirloom teas. It is a measurable reality. The soil composition, altitude, humidity, and companion plant species surrounding a tea garden directly influence the chemical compounds the plant produces and, by extension, the flavor in the cup.

Ancient tea gardens like Jinping Village retain centuries-old heirloom bushes growing in natural, rocky, bamboo-rich environments. The bamboo provides shade that slows leaf development, increasing amino acid concentration and producing the umami-adjacent sweetness that distinguishes these teas. Rocky, mineral-dense soil forces roots to work harder and deeper, pulling up trace minerals that show up as a clean, stony finish in the brewed cup.

Key ecological factors that define heirloom tea character:

  • Altitude: High-altitude gardens experience cooler temperatures and greater diurnal temperature swings. Slower growth concentrates flavor compounds.
  • Soil type: Rocky, well-drained soils with low nitrogen content stress the plant productively, increasing polyphenol and amino acid levels.
  • Companion plants: Bamboo, wild orchids, and native shrubs in traditional gardens contribute to the aromatic environment the tea plant grows in.
  • Canopy cover: Partial shade from forest canopy or bamboo reduces photosynthesis rate, increasing theanine and reducing bitterness.

Heirloom gardens represent living history, with tea bushes growing in traditional landscapes that directly affect flavor complexity. Why heirloom teas deserve more attention than they get

The tea world has spent decades optimizing for yield and consistency. That optimization produced reliable, affordable tea at scale. It also flattened the flavor spectrum considerably. When I taste a well-sourced Qun Ti Zhong or an old-tree Yunnan heirloom, the difference from a clonal equivalent is not subtle. It is the difference between a photograph and a painting of the same landscape.

What strikes me most is how much genetic diversity functions as a form of insurance. A field of genetically identical clonal plants is one bad season away from a catastrophic loss. A heirloom garden, with its population of genetically distinct individuals, distributes that risk across hundreds of unique plants. Growers who understand this are not just preserving flavor. They are preserving a biological safety net.

FAQ

What are heirloom tea varieties in simple terms?

Heirloom tea varieties are seed-grown tea plants where every bush is genetically unique, producing complex, layered flavors that clonal cultivars cannot replicate. The Chinese term for this category is Qun Ti Zhong.

How do I identify an heirloom tea bush in a garden?

Look for irregular bud sizes, mixed leaf morphologies, and variation in leaf color across adjacent plants. Uniform, identical-looking bushes in a row are almost always clonal in origin.

What are the main heirloom tea benefits for health?

Ancient heirloom trees, some 200–500 years old, accumulate elevated levels of theacrine, anthocyanins, and polyphenols. These compounds are associated with antioxidant activity and the complex flavor profiles that make heirloom teas distinct from commercial varieties.

Why are heirloom teas harder to find than clonal teas?

Clonal varieties like Longjing #43 sprout earlier and yield more predictably, giving commercial producers a strong economic incentive to plant them. Heirloom gardens require more labor, produce lower yields, and miss the premium early-harvest price window.

Can I grow heirloom tea at home?

Seed-grown heirloom tea plants can be cultivated in containers or garden beds with well-drained, acidic soil and partial shade. The key challenge is sourcing verified heirloom seed stock, since most commercially available tea plants are clonal cuttings.
